1 |
[ noun ] (zoology) woolly usually horned ruminant mammal related to the goat

2 |
[ noun ] a timid defenseless simpleton who is readily preyed upon

3 |
[ noun ] a docile and vulnerable person who would rather follow than make an independent decision
Examples "his students followed him like sheep" Related terms |
